Job Opportunity – ICU Registered Nurse – Pennsylvania

Start Date: October 5, 2026

Location: Pennsylvania

Compensation: Details provided to qualified applicants

Schedule: Every other weekend required; 24-hour orientation period; floating to other units as needed based on census

Highlights:
  • ICU setting in a community hospital environment serving as the highest level of care
  • 2:3 patient ratio managing a variety of critical care conditions
  • EPIC charting system utilized for all patient documentation
  • 8-bed unit with comprehensive interdisciplinary support including IV teams, respiratory services, pharmacy, and physical therapy
  • Diverse patient population including adolescents, adults, and geriatrics
  • First-time travelers welcome with appropriate experience
Requirements:
  • Active Pennsylvania RN license or compact license in hand at time of submission
  • Minimum 2 years of ICU nursing experience required
  • Current BLS, ACLS, and NIHSS certifications required
  • EPIC charting experience required
  • Community hospital experience required
  • Trauma Level I or II experience preferred
  • Previous charge nurse experience preferred
  • Pennsylvania state fingerprinting and child abuse clearances required
  • Flu vaccination required (medical/religious exemptions only)
